- AAndreSan Francisco Bay Area •11 reviews4.0Dined on 15 Feb 2025We went to The Brixton for a Valentine’s Day dinner, and while we have seen this place in the neighborhood for a few years, and longer, this was our first time dining here. They gave my wife a rose, which was a VERY nice touch and this place was packed and everyone was also here for a Valentine’s Day dinner, as to be expected. Being packed, I think, absolutely affected the food quality. It wasn’t bad, and it wasn’t great either. We ordered cocktails that showed up quickly and we’re very tasty. Our appetizers were a spinach and artichoke dip, which was very tasty. The kale caesar salad with lima beans was good. My wife ordered the baked chicken which was lovely. I ordered the filet mignon - medium rare. It came out medium well. Despite sitting literally next to the kitchen, I saw how backed up it was and didn’t have the heart to send it back. The back-of-house resembled an episode from “The Bear”, because it was that busy. I just wish I got a steak knife and our server was so swamped, I couldn’t catch her to get one. I would like to point out that our server was as sweet as can be, along with the other staff handling our food. I think the biggest miss of the night was when we ordered dessert, and it was the sundae. I think it took us anywhere from 45 minutes to an hour to get it. I mean we didn’t mind because it allowed us to stretch out our date, yet didn’t The Brixton want to turn over our table? They could have easily asked us if we wanted more cocktails while we waited, and we would have absolutely ordered more, because why not?. This would have resulted in ordering something with higher profit margins and they could have then comp’d us on the sundae for the long wait, which would have changed the trajectory of this review, and of the immediate possibility of giving this place another try. Would I go back to The Brixton? Maybe. I’ll give them a little grace for being busy.
